Midlands Towns Set For A €750,000 Makeover

Just under €750,000 is being allocated to improve shopfronts and streets in midlands towns. 

It's part of a €7 million Streetscape Enhancement Initiative announced by the government. 

Local authorities across Ireland have been assigned a budget based on the number of towns in the county. 

Offaly and Laois will receive €260,000 each while Westmeath is being given €220,000 euro for improvements.
